分类目录归档:linux

influxdb过期策略

SHOW RETENTION POLICIES ON db 命令显示过期策略

> SHOW RETENTION POLICIES ON dbname
name    duration shardGroupDuration replicaN default
----    -------- -[......]

阅读全文

发表在 linux, 大数据 | 留下评论

CPU绑定和IRQ相关

查看cpu在干嘛

[root@zwserver ~]# mpstat -P ALL 1
Linux 3.10.0-693.el7.x86_64 (zwserver)  2018年04月10日  _x86_64_        (4 CPU)

19时43分23秒  CPU    %usr   %n[......]

阅读全文

发表在 linux | 留下评论

nginx内置变量备忘

参数
说明
示例

$remote_addr
客户端地址
211.28.65.253

$remote_user
客户端用户名称

$time_local
访问时间和时区
18/Jul/2012:17:00:01 +0800

$re[……]

阅读全文

发表在 linux | 标签为 | 留下评论

禁用sshd的反向解析,提高登录速度

ssh连上服务器的时间经常很慢,主要是卡住反向查询客户端ip对应的域名慢,可以禁用

#vi /etc/ssh/sshd_config
UseDNS no

[……]

阅读全文

发表在 linux | 留下评论

linux常用命令备忘

在文件中查找内容

find  ./ -name "*" |xargs grep -in "connect"
grep -Fnr connect  ./

tcpdump抓包

tcpdump -i eth1 port 16379 -s 0 -w 1.cap
-s 0表示保存完整包内容,否则只有1[......]

阅读全文

发表在 linux | 留下评论

mysql常用命令

mysql -S /tmp/mysql2.sock

mysqld_multi start 3
change master to
master_host='10.240.39.21',
master_user='root',
master_password='123456',
master_po[......]

阅读全文

发表在 linux | 留下评论

linux常见业务启动停止命令

  • logstash:
    bin/logstash -f config.conf &

  • php,
    启动 /usr/local/php/sbin/php-fpm &
    动态加载 kill -USR2 cat /usr/local/php/var/run/php-fpm.pid

  • redi[……]

    阅读全文

发表在 linux | 留下评论

nginx支持https

https协议有很多种算法,tls系列、ssl系列。ssl由于出了漏洞所以安全性较低

苹果要求ATS(未正式开始强制要求)的https和微信小程序的https要求如下:
* 支持tls1.2协议
* 禁止ssl协议
* 签名算法为SHA2

ats和微信小程序同时支持的nginx配置如下:

[......]

阅读全文

发表在 linux | 标签为 | 留下评论

nginx配置备忘

php解析

server {
                listen       8082;
                server_name  xx.ss.com;
                server_name  1.2.2.3;
                set $[......]

阅读全文

发表在 linux | 标签为 | 留下评论

查看进程当前栈pstack

pstack pid 命令
对php进程也有效,php慢日志外的另一个定位php慢的方法

ps: php慢日志开启方法

php-pfm.ini

[www]
slowlog = /tmp/php_slow.log

pstack 其实是一个对gbd命令进行封账的脚本

#!/bin/sh[......]

阅读全文

发表在 linux | 留下评论